Velvety leaves patterned with herringbone veins that fold up like praying hands at night. A charming, pet-safe trailer that loves warmth and humidity.

About Prayer Plant
Maranta leuconeura is an moderate-growing indoor plant in the Marantaceae family. It reaches around 30 cm tall at maturity, with evergreen, variegated and purple-toned foliage.
Where to grow Prayer Plant
Prayer Plant suits tropical and subtropical climates and grows best in part shade or morning sun and shade and low-light positions. It is frost tender, so protect it from hard frosts or grow it in a sheltered spot or pot.

Good to know
It is regarded as non-toxic and pet-safe.
